UK Rejoices As Tour Lands TV Provider In Time For Travelers

Now I can sleep...

PGA TOUR, Eurosport announce UK television rights agreement for remainder of 2009 season
Telecasts to reach more than 10 million UK homes

PONTE VEDRA BEACH, FL JUNE 25, 2009

The PGA TOUR and Eurosport today jointly announced an agreement in which Eurosport has secured the PGA TOUR television rights in UK for the remainder of the 2009 TOUR season, beginning tonight, Thursday, June 25, with live coverage from the Travelers Championship in Cromwell, Connecticut.

Action from the remaining 2009 TOUR events will now be accessible in more than 10 million UK homes on British Eurosport and British Eurosport 2, through Sky and Virgin Media platforms.

“We are pleased to announce this agreement with Eurosport, which ensures that PGA TOUR coverage will continue to be made available, live, every week to golf fans throughout the United Kingdom,” said PGA TOUR Commissioner Tim Finchem.

“We are delighted to welcome the US PGA TOUR to the Eurosport platform in the UK,” said Eurosport Chairman Laurent Eric Le Lay. “British golf fans can now see the world’s best players competing live as the 2009 season unfolds. We can give the US PGA TOUR’s iconic tournaments excellent coverage across our two UK TV channels, and fans can follow regular news and results at Eurosport’s leading sports website.”

The PGA TOUR telecasts will also be available to UK fans in simulcast through Eurosport’s online subscription service, Eurosport Player.
